What is a Technical Program Manager at Deepmind?

The Technical Program Manager (TPM) at Deepmind serves as the connective tissue between cutting-edge artificial intelligence research and scalable engineering execution. In an environment where the boundary of what is possible is constantly being redefined, your role is to translate high-level research objectives into concrete, actionable milestones. You are the architect of processes that allow teams to maintain velocity while navigating the inherent ambiguity of long-term AI development.

Your impact is felt across the entire product lifecycle, from initial concept to deployment. Whether you are working on Gemini audio initiatives, Frontier Safety, or Robotics, you are responsible for managing complex dependencies, mitigating technical risks, and ensuring cross-functional alignment. This role demands a unique balance of technical literacy and program management rigor, as you will frequently partner with world-class researchers and engineers to deliver solutions that push the state of the art in machine learning.

Common Interview Questions

Interview questions at Deepmind are designed to probe your ability to handle complex, large-scale technical programs while maintaining a collaborative and structured approach. The following categories represent core patterns identified in recent hiring cycles.

Behavioral and Leadership

These questions evaluate your influence, conflict resolution skills, and how you lead teams through periods of intense change or ambiguity.

  • Tell me about a time you had to deliver a project with significant technical ambiguity.
  • Describe a situation where you had to influence a senior stakeholder who disagreed with your technical roadmap.

Getting Ready for Your Interviews

Preparation for Deepmind requires a shift from standard project management methodologies toward a mindset of technical program leadership. You must demonstrate that you can understand the "how" behind the technology while focusing on the "what" and "why" of the program.

Technical Fluency – You are not expected to be an AI researcher, but you must be able to communicate effectively with those who are. Demonstrate that you understand the lifecycle of machine learning models and the unique challenges of scaling AI research.

Programmatic Rigor – Interviewers look for your ability to build structure in chaotic environments. Show how you use data to track progress, identify bottlenecks, and make informed decisions about resource allocation.

Influence and Collaboration – At Deepmind, success is rarely a solo endeavor. Highlight how you build consensus, manage stakeholder expectations, and keep diverse groups of experts aligned on a singular vision.

Interview Process Overview

The Deepmind interview process is characterized by its rigor, structure, and focus on both technical capability and cultural alignment. While the number of rounds can vary depending on the specific team and seniority, the process is consistently professional, transparent, and designed to provide you with a comprehensive view of the organization.

You will typically progress from an initial recruiter screen to a series of deep-dive interviews covering technical proficiency, program management methodology, and behavioral competencies. The pace is designed to be steady, and interviewers are generally highly responsive. The process often emphasizes peer-to-peer collaboration, meaning you should be prepared to discuss your work in a way that respects the intellectual depth of your interviewers.

Deep Dive into Evaluation Areas

Strategic Program Execution

This area evaluates your ability to translate vision into reality. Strong candidates provide clear examples of how they set project scopes, managed budgets, and delivered results under tight constraints.

  • Risk Management – Proactive identification of technical and operational blockers.
  • Dependency Tracking – Coordinating between research, engineering, and product teams.
  • Resource Allocation – Balancing team capacity against project priority.

Technical Communication

How you explain complex technical concepts to non-technical stakeholders or translate business goals for engineers is critical.

  • Cross-functional alignment – Ensuring researchers and engineers speak the same language.
  • Stakeholder management – Providing clear, concise updates to leadership.
  • Documentation – Maintaining clear records of decisions and project status.

Key Responsibilities

As a Technical Program Manager at Deepmind, you will act as the primary driver for high-impact initiatives. You will spend your day facilitating communication between specialized teams, such as those working on Gemini Robotics or Agents Innovation. Your responsibilities include refining project roadmaps, tracking technical dependencies, and ensuring that safety and alignment protocols are integrated into the development cycle from the outset.

You will often find yourself in the middle of complex trade-off discussions, requiring you to weigh the benefits of rapid experimentation against the stability requirements of production systems. By maintaining a high-level view of the program, you enable researchers and engineers to focus on their core expertise while you clear the path for execution.

Role Requirements & Qualifications

Successful candidates at Deepmind typically possess a strong blend of technical background and seasoned program management expertise.

  • Must-have skills:
    • Demonstrated experience in managing large-scale, cross-functional technical programs.
    • Ability to navigate and thrive in ambiguous, fast-paced environments.
    • Strong technical literacy, particularly in areas related to software development or machine learning.
    • Proven track record of influencing senior leadership and cross-functional teams.
  • Nice-to-have skills:
    • Direct experience in the AI or ML industry.
    • Background in safety-critical systems or research-heavy product environments.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How long does the typical interview process take? Most candidates experience a process spanning 3 to 6 weeks. While this can vary based on team needs, the structure is generally consistent and well-communicated by your recruiter.

Q: What is the most important trait for a TPM at Deepmind? The ability to maintain structure in ambiguity is paramount. You must be able to define the path forward when the requirements are evolving and the technical challenges are novel.

Q: Is the technical bar very high? The bar is high in terms of understanding the technical ecosystem, but you are not expected to code or perform research. You must, however, be able to engage in meaningful technical discussions with world-class engineers.

Other General Tips

  • Structure your answers: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to keep your answers crisp and data-driven.
  • Be curious about the tech: Show genuine interest in the specific AI domain the team is working on, whether it is audio, robotics, or alignment.
  • Focus on the "why": When discussing past projects, explain why you chose a specific management approach and what the trade-offs were.
